9787. Glucagon
Description
Glucagon is a polypeptide hormone synthesized by the alpha cells of the pancreas. Elevated glucagon levels are a marker of glucagonoma.
When and who needs the test?
Diagnosis and monitoring of patients with glucagonoma and other glucagon-secreting tumors (hepatocellular carcinoma, carcinoid tumors, neuroendocrine tumors)
